National University of Singapore-ISS M.Tech Admissions – January 2012 Session

National University of Singapore (NUS) in collaboration with Institute of Systems Science (ISS) is offering Master of Technology (M.Tech) in Software Engineering / Knowledge Engineering for the Session to be commenced from January 2012. The programme is jointly offered by the Institute of Systems Science, the Department of Electrical and Computer Engineering and the School of Computing at the National University of Singapore. The completion of the program will lead to the award of a Masters degree by the National University of Singapore. The programmes are designed to meet the needs of software and IT industry. Duration of the programme is a minimum of two and one-half years and a maximum of five years of part-time study. The programme is also offered on a full-time basis with a duration of over a minimum period of one and half years. Following are details of eligibility and application procedure:

Eligibility Requirements: Applicants should possess an undergraduate degree, preferably in Science or Engineering and a grade point average of at least B. They should have at least 2 years relevant working experience. For the Software Engineering and Knowledge Engineering programmes, the work experience of the candidates must be as an IT professional.

Candidates should have passed an entrance test conducted by ISS or have achieved a satisfactory score in the GRE general test. They should have received a favourable assessment at an admissions interview conducted by ISS. Candidates need high proficiency in the English language in both spoken and written formats. International applicants who studied Graduation from universities where English is not the medium of instruction may also be asked to take TOEFL / IELTS. Candidates with equivalent degrees of an NUS / NTU honours degree, masters degree or Ph.D. in computer science, computer engineering or electrical engineering
(or similar) will be exempted from taking the entrance test.

Best Chemistry Teacher Award 2011 by Tata Chemicals and ACT

Tata Chemicals Limited (TCL) in association with Association of Chemistry Teachers (ACT) is inviting nominations for Best Chemistry Teacher Awards to commemorate the International Year of Chemistry 2011. The United Nations (UN) is celebrating this year as the IYC 2011. This is an excellent initiative worldwide to focus on the achievements of Chemistry and its contributions to the well being of humankind. More details of UN declaration on International Year of Chemistry are available on www.chemistry2011.org . Following are details of Best Chemistry Teacher Awards 2011:

Tata Chemicals has instituted the Best Chemistry Teacher Award to appreciate the efforts of exemplary individuals those involved in teaching Chemistry and its allied subjects / components at various levels of education. The nominees for this prestigious award could be teachers from class XI and XII (Intermediate), undergraduate courses (Bachelor Courses) and Post Graduate levels. Tata Chemicals Limited (TCL) is part of this initiative to reward Chemistry teachers through its Human Touch of Chemistry Campaign. The company has initiated an exclusive website www.humantouchofchemistry.com to inculcate and promote the love for chemistry subject in young minds. Following are award categories:

1) Best Chemistry Teacher (For Class XI / XII and equivalent): This is for those teaching class XI / XII, Junior College, + 2 levels and Diploma courses.

2) Best Chemistry Teacher (For Bachelors Degree and equivalent): The award is for those involved in teaching at the levels of Bachelors Degree in Science, Engineering or any other Graduate courses.

3) Best Chemistry Teacher (For Masters Degree and above): This award is for those candidates involved in teaching at the levels of Masters degree in Science, Engineering, or any other Post-Graduate, Doctoral, Post-Doctoral courses or their equivalent.

4) Best Chemistry Teacher (for innovation in teaching).
5) Best Chemistry Teacher (for the promotion of Chemistry as a specialised subject.)
6) Most Popular Chemistry Teacher (This will be purely based on social media response.)
